A lot of problems in our world could be helped with better communication, says Samantha Mills who is studying a Bachelor of Communication Studies in Public Relations, with minors in Brand and Advertising Creativity and Health Promotion.

“I really think skills around communication are important for all areas of work globally. After I graduate, I’d love to be a part of the health PR world, either working for an agency or in house for a company. I want to be involved in the creativity needed to ensure messages reach the target audience while also helping to make sure this is done ethically.”

Being able to study other subjects as part of her Bachelor of Communication Studies will prepare her for this goal.

“The things you’re learning will complement each other and ultimately enrich your learning overall. I chose to study brand and advertising creativity because I was excited by the chance to have a go at creating engaging ads and to learn about all that goes on behind the scenes. Health promotion was equally important to me as I’ve come to really care how messages are communicated in the health and wellness world.”
